Atrial fibrillation (AF) increases the risk of stroke and systemic embolism. While oral anticoagulation is the current standard of care, there is a growing body of evidence supporting left atrial appendage closure (LAAC) as an alternative or complementary treatment approach to reduce the risk of stroke or systemic embolism in patients with AF.

In this paper, the authors completed a propensity matched retrospective observational study to compare long-term outcomes of isolated mechanical versus bioprosthetic mitral valves in different age groups. After propensity matching, analysis was completed in two age groups: < 65 and 65–75 years.

This paper reports the interim findings from the clinical registry that was initiated after FDA approval to validate the findings of the 386 PROACT trial for the On-X aortic valve. The original trial showed that low dose warfarin (INR range 1.5-2.0) and aspirin were safe starting at least three months after On-X aortic valve implantation.

The COMICS trial is the largest randomized trial of minimally invasive extracorporeal circulation (MiECC) compared to conventional ECC (CECC). MiECC reduced the frequency of SAEs prespecified to qualify for the primary outcome.

This paper details an under-development animal model to study the vascular pathology of vein grafts in a variation of the initial Carrel canine bypass experiment. The possible findings on detrimental effects of hydrostatic distention, if and when quantified, may alter surgeons’ harvesting techniques.
